Achievement has been the focus this year both in the classroom and outside. In the classroom we stress organization, creativity and work ethic. The beginning of the third quarter marked the introduction of Operation Success. Operation Success has been aimed at stressing to our students that failure is not an acceptable option. When students near that mark at any check point (every three weeks), he/she must attend Operation Success after school. At Operation Success, students are taught organizational structures and help with assignments is available. This program has helped many students achieve to a higher level throughout the quarter. We want each of our students to consistently strive to do their best. Thank you to all our parents who make sacrifices to transport their student to Operation Success in order to teach these values and skills.
